Team Kenya national Captain John Lejirma will be leading his squad to the 2024 Region IV Golf Championship set to take place in Kigali, Rwanda.

The four-man team selected by Kenya Golf Union (KGU) are Kiambu's Michael Karanga who currently leads in Kenya Amateur Golf Ranking) (KAGR) Series with 693 points and Lejirma of Kenya Railways currently ranked second and also the team Captain.

Others are Kiambu's youngster Elvis Muigua ranked third and Nyali's Adel Balala who is ranked fourth.

The Championship is set to take place from Friday, October 4th to 6th at the Kigali Golf Resort and Villas in Rwanda where team Kenya will be defending their title for the third time in the coveted trophy formerly known as the East Africa Challenge.

Lejirma noted that they are truly honored to represent Kenya on this grand stage and have trained rigorously hand in hand with the help of their Coach John Liefland saying they are very ready for the challenge and conveyed strong confidence in the team's readiness.

"I'm confident that the team is in great shape, and we will come back with the trophy. We are the defending champions twice in a row and we aim to bring glory to our Country this year again and I want to take this opportunity to thank our supporters for their unwavering support and also believing in us. I urge all the people at large to come together in supporting and cheering our own. We are ready to go out there and show the world what Kenya is made of in terms of Golf Sport, "said Lejirma.

According to KGU, the team will depart for Rwanda on Wednesday, October 2nd, where they will compete against Uganda, Tanzania, Burundi, South Sudan, Seychelles, Reunion and the host nation Rwanda.

Accompanying the team is the KGU tournament Director Chris Kinuthia who confirmed that the team has undergone rigorous training for the past month under the guidance of National Team Coach John Van Liefland.

Kenya team goes to the Championship with their heads high after retaining the title at the 2023 Africa Region Four Golf Championships played at the Par 71 Addis Ababa Golf Club in Ethiopia.

Kenya team had comprised captain Dennis Maara from Limuru, Michael Karang from Kiambu, John lejirma of Kenya railways and youngster Elvis Muigua from Kiambu who fired a total of three under par to complete the championships with (+12) 864 and retained the title they won in 2022 in Uganda.
